Burton-on-Trent station is especially equipped to handle ticketing needs efficiently. Its ticket office is open throughout the week, with operating hours from early morning at 6:10 AM till evening. For those buying tickets online or via mobile, ticket machines are available, alongside accessible ticket machines to ensure convenience for all passengers. Furthermore, the station is equipped with an induction loop to assist those with hearing impairments, showcasing its commitment to accessibility.
The station is staffed from morning until late at night on weekdays and Saturdays, offering customer assistance at various points across the site. Information displays for departures and arrivals are kept up to date, and help points are strategically placed for ease of access. While most facilities are comprehensive, the amenity for luggage storage is not present; however, they do coordinate with the EMR lost property office in Nottingham should any items be misplaced.
For those needing to freshen up before their journey, the presence of toilets, including accessible facilities and baby changing stations, on Platform 2 provides added convenience. With waiting rooms available during ticket office hours and an ample seating area, comfort is never compromised.
Beyond the rail network, Burton-on-Trent station connects passengers to alternative transport services. Nearby, taxis can be hailed for direct routes to your destination, with reliable local services available through contacts such as Station Taxis and New Street Taxis. Bus services are also accessible, and detailed onward travel information can be found online, helping plan your post-arrival journey with ease. If alternative transport is required due to service disruptions, a rail replacement service is conveniently located right outside the station.
In terms of accessibility, the station ensures step-free access across its platforms, complemented by tactile paving for visually impaired passengers. Although no ticket barriers are present, the facility accommodates six accessible parking spaces, adhering to various mobility needs. With a comprehensive car park open 24/7, managed by East Midlands Railway, parking fees are structured to offer flexibility—even including special weekend rates.

While Pembrey & Burry Port doesn't have a staffed ticket office, it provides ticket machines that accept major debit and credit cards, making it convenient for travellers to collect and purchase rail tickets. These machines are accessible for all users, including those with mobility issues, ensuring a seamless travel experience. Though the station lacks certain facilities like induction loops and waiting rooms, passengers can rely on departure and arrival screens for up-to-date travel information. Despite the absence of CCTV, there are several helplines and customer service contacts available to assist with queries and support.
For those requiring extra help, the station is partially equipped with step-free access, making it a Category B1 station. This allows easy access to Platform 1 towards Swansea and Platform 2 towards Carmarthen. The platforms are connected via a footbridge with steps or the road bridge with a pavement. While waiting for your train, you can find bicycle storage facilities, including lockers, supported by Carmarthenshire County Council’s adjacent car park, providing ample parking for cyclists keen on exploring the area.
Pembrey & Burry Port train station also offers several onward travel options. Located near the station, a rail replacement bus stop is available at a local bus stop on Seaview Terrace. Taxi services are conveniently positioned in Stepney Road, just opposite the police station, ideal for those who prefer direct transport to their next destination. Although there aren’t any cycle hire facilities on-site, cyclists can lock their bikes securely at the available storage spaces, encouraging eco-friendly travel around the vibrant locales of Carmarthenshire.
